How to Fix a Upvc Door Locking Mechanism

There are a variety of reasons why an Upvc door locking mechanism may not function correctly. It could be a loose or damaged lock, a damaged hinge or misalignment. It is also possible to have damage caused by an intruder.

Adjusting butt hinges

If you have an uPVC door and it's not locking properly, you may need to adjust butt hinges. To do this, you must open the door and remove all caps protecting it. Next turn the adjustment slots' pins clockwise and counterclockwise.

Start by leveling the door before you adjust the uPVC hinges. To mark the point of entry you can make use of a spirit-level or marker pen. Once the door is level, you can move the adjusters on the top and bottom away.

Depending on the model of your uPVC door, you might require removing the caps protecting it to open the slot. You'll require a Phillips, or cross-head screwdriver, to accomplish this. After removing the caps, it is possible to loosen the screws and remove the slot caps.

Then, you'll need an Allen key. Most uPVC doors come with one adjustment slot per hinge. Some uPVC door models may require an Allen key. Other models won't have slots for adjustment.

Butt hinges on uPVC doors are usually found on older uPVC doors. However, you can also find newer designs that allow for side-to-side movement. Newer butt hinges may require a Phillips or cross-head screwdriver.

Flag hinges can be adjusted on uPVC doors. These hinges offer two different types of adjustments: height and compression. Each hinge has an adjustable pin that runs through the top of the hinge attached to the door. The adjustment will allow you to open or close horizontally, vertically, or both.

Some uPVC door models also feature the ability to adjust the lateral. This adjustment allows you move the hinge closer towards the jamb. This is usually hidden under a plastic cover.

Misalignment

If your UPVC door is squeaking, it could be due to a misalignment of the lock mechanism. It doesn't matter whether the problem is simple or complex; however, it should be addressed immediately by an expert.

There are many reasons for misalignment can happen, including damaged hinges, cracked or damaged glass panels, improper packing, and damaged hinges. Temperature changes can also cause doors to expand and contract, which could lead to misalignment.

The process of getting your uPVC door aligned should be an easy and quick process. It usually takes less than five minutes. A spirit level can be used to check the distance between your door frame and sash.

Cool water can also be used to dowse your doors. This can correct alignment problems. It will only take just a few seconds, and could save you money on repairs.

One of the biggest issues with UPVC doors is the widespreadness of misalignment. This is especially true of older hinges that aren't meant to be adjusted. A malfunctioning locking mechanism could show up as an indication of trouble, even if the issue is only an unintentional disalignment.

It's often overlooked, but exposure to the elements can be a big factor in causing alignment issues. For instance, driveway sand can block the frame of your door.

A poorly packed door panel may result in an unevenly aligned UPVC door. This can result in issues with locking and unlocking or make the handle not fit properly.

In extreme weather conditions that are extreme, your UPVC door could expand or contract. Although this isn't necessarily a bad thing however, it could cause issues with your uPVC door locking mechanism.

You can adjust the hinges on your door or modify the locks to correct the misalignment. Your local Locksmith will be able to help you determine the steps needed to bring your door back into good working condition.

Sticking

It can be a challenge when your door lock made of uPVC mechanism is stuck. However there are some ways to get it fixed. First, you have to determine why the lock is stuck.

There are many reasons why locks might be stuck. One of them is the extreme heat of summer. Broken springs are another cause. A damaged spring could cause the lock to fail. Fortunately, a broken spring can be repaired by your local locksmith.

To determine whether or not your lock is stuck, you'll need remove it from the door and check it out. If the lock is stuck, it's likely be difficult to turn the lever. Also, you can check whether the door is in the middle.

A door that is aligned properly will be able to move effortlessly and won't get caught when it is closed. A door that isn't at the center could make it difficult to open. Adjusting the hinges can fix this problem.

You can use a key to open the lock even if it's not locked. A deadbolt is an option for some doors. Chains can also help deter intruders.

There are a variety of alternatives for uPVC door locks. When it comes to selecting the right lock, you must be aware of the brand and model of the door. A poorly designed or cheap lock could cause more trouble than it resolves.

It is also recommended to lubricate hinges in addition to locking them. WD40 is a good option. Warm water can be used to achieve the same effect in colder seasons.
